Onboarding: Almsgiver receipt mailer — plugin basics

Plugin authors: Almsgiver renders donation receipts from your templates, signs them, and queues delivery. Your plugin must declare a template ID, handle the render-failed callback, and never mutate donor totals. Sandbox is reset nightly; don't store state there. Rate limit: 200 renders/min per plugin. Test against the golden-receipt fixtures before requesting review. To decrypt the sandbox signing keystore for local testing, use the recovery passphrase below.

unlock words, kawig-bawef: belax-sorir-druax-ulaiel-wenael-belael

**Handover: PedalShift rebalancer**

Welcome, and thanks for picking this up. PedalShift recomputes bike-share station targets every fifteen minutes and dispatches van routes accordingly. The optimizer is sensitive to the demand-weight settings, so please don't change them without running the Greywick backtest first. For your reference, the service currently runs with the following configuration:

deployment values, bajop-yahaf:
[holax]
host = holax.tolvaqsys.corp
user = holax_svc
database = holax_prod

# Bouncehound Environments

Bouncehound (email bounce processor) runs in three environments: dev, staging, prod. Dev uses a stubbed SMTP sink; staging mirrors 5% of prod bounce traffic via the Greymarsh relay. Prod is dual-region, active-passive. Reviewers: changes to parsing rules must pass the staging replay suite before merge. Queue depth alarms differ per environment. The staging instance currently runs with the configuration below.

service settings:
[casax]
port = 6379
team = rusir
host = casax.zemvarhq.corp
region = outer-4
access_code = ac_9808ce
timeout_ms = 1500

MEMO — Kettling Depot Receiving

Uniform sets for the new Kettling depot arrive Wednesday via Ashgrove courier: 40 boxes, sorted by size, manifest attached to box one. Check the count at the dock before signing; shortages go straight to stores, not the courier. The hand-over instruction the courier will follow is set out below.

drop instructions, tafof-baguf: the holmir gilox courier leaves the sormir ulaok holdor ledger at gate 5596 under passcode 257343